全球数百万人已经选择WordPress作为他们建站的首选应用程序。他们怎么可能不呢?– 突出的 CMS 以其极致的灵活性、轻松的定制和不断的升级轻松地让用户惊叹。但通常情况下,网站管理员必须在多个 WordPress 实例之间兼顾,而且随着他们管理的帐户数量的增加,负担只会越来越重。幸运的是,WordPress 也有针对该问题的解决方案——引入WordPress Multisite!今天,我们将详细了解 WP 的多站点功能——它是什么,谁可以受益,以及如何在您的帐户上轻松配置它?
什么是 WordPress 多站点?
WordPress Multisite (WPMU)是一种安装类型,允许用户通过同一仪表板管理和自定义多个 WP 实例。您可以创建一个完整的网站网络,并使用一个登录用户名和密码轻松进行更改。此外,您可以添加更多用户并为他们分配不同的访问权限。
例如,您是一名 Web 开发人员,同时处理不同的客户项目。除了您自己,站点所有者和各种团队成员可能还需要访问他们的特定网站。作为管理员,您可以在不影响其他项目的情况下将用户分配到他们的特定页面。 使用WPMU的一个很好的例子是WordPress.com。最流行的 CMS 的商业分支提供单独的用户帐户,而开发人员保持对每个帐户包含的内容的完全控制。
WordPress 多站点优势
管理多个 WordPress 网站后,您很快就会意识到,如果您不浪费宝贵的时间一直在帐户之间切换,您的运营可以更高效地运行。
但 WordPress Multisite 提供的远不止于此:
- 快速访问许多博客——没有比利用这个绝妙的壮举更好的处理多个 WordPress 网站的方法了。一个用户名、一个密码、一个仪表板——没有比 WPMU 更简单和用户友好的了。
- 共享主题和插件- 在这里您的效率可以达到顶峰。WP 的许多附加组件都是多站点兼容的,您可以轻松地只安装一次主题或插件,然后在您控制的不同 WordPress 页面上使用它。
- 单个WordPress 安装– 与附加组件一样,WordPress Multisite 可以为您节省大量实际核心 WP 安装的时间。当然,最初的 CMS 设置不会超过几分钟,但是当您必须处理数百个网站时,数字会迅速增加。
- 单点升级——当需要升级您的应用程序或插件时,多站点最有利可图的好处之一就会闪耀。您可以轻松优化流程并将新版本一次应用于多个页面。
- 多个访问级别——使用 WordPress 多站点时,您充当超级管理员。因此,您可以完全控制分配您下面的角色——谁可以访问哪些网站以及他们可以使用的选项种类。
谁可能需要 WordPress 多站点?
WordPress Multisite 在 WP 中是一个小众选项,因为只管理单个项目的网站管理员并没有真正使用这个功能。但对于许多其他个人和企业而言,这可以节省大量时间。
这包括:
- 网络开发人员和设计师
- 网络代理
- 经销商
- 国际企业
- 营销专家
- 社区团体
现在我们已经确定了 WPMU 的基本要素,是时候学习如何在我们的网络托管服务器上配置它了。
如何创建 WordPress 多站点网络?
在开始配置 WPMU 之前,您需要确保拥有可靠的托管服务提供商和经过优化的服务器,以完美地处理您的网络流量。 一旦你解决了这个问题,你只需要按照以下步骤操作:
- 通过FTP 客户端或控制面板中的文件管理器连接到您的服务器。
- 找到wp-config.php 文件并使用您选择的文本编辑器打开它。
- 查找行:
/* 就这些,停止编辑!快乐的博客。*/
在其上方,粘贴以下代码:
/* 多站点 */
定义('WP_ALLOW_MULTISITE',真);
- 保存编辑后的文件。
- 现在,前往您的 WordPress 仪表板。转到工具->网络设置。
- 在下一个屏幕上,您需要选择网络中的网站是位于子域(如 site.yourdomain.com)还是子目录(yourdomain.com/site)中。请谨慎选择,因为您以后无法更改此选择。
- 输入您的管理员凭据并点击安装按钮。
- 您现在位于网络设置屏幕上。它应该看起来像这样:
- 您需要复制此代码并将其粘贴到两个不同的文件中—— wp-config.php和.htaccess。
- 保存并关闭修改后的文件。如果系统要求覆盖任何数据——您可以安全地这样做。
您现在将在 WordPress 仪表板中看到一个新菜单——我的网站。单击它,您将找到各种网络管理员和站点管理选项。
管理您的 WordPress 多站点网络
作为超级管理员,您可以完全控制网络中的所有网站。如果您访问您的 WP 仪表板并转到我的站点->网络管理员->站点,您将看到一堆有用的选项。在他们的帮助下,您可以:
- 添加新网站——您只需输入网站URL、标题、语言和管理员电子邮件。创建后,您可以在“站点”屏幕中看到新页面。
- 编辑网站设置——这个屏幕包含大量关于网站、用户、主题等的简洁选项。您不能从此处对网站内容进行任何更改。
- 停用网站——这将对任何网站访问者隐藏所选网站。相反,他们会看到内容不可用的消息。
- 存档网站——只有您作为超级管理员才能看到存档页面。所有其他用户和网站访问者将收到一条消息,表明该网站已被存档或暂停。
- 将站点标记为垃圾邮件——您不想在您的网络中保留任何垃圾页面,因此您可以轻松地标记那些违反规则的页面。
还有很多。如您所见——网络所有者可能需要的一切都只需点击几下。
WordPress 多站点和虚拟主机
既然我们知道 WPMU 的作用以及我们如何受益,我们如何为我们的网络选择合适的托管服务提供商?选择我们的下一个主机时是否有任何特殊要求需要注意?虽然管理 WordPress 多站点网络并没有什么特别的要求,但您仍然必须确保以下几点:
- 为所有站点和数据库提供足够的磁盘空间
- 足够的服务器资源来处理所有网站
- 域注册和管理选项
- WordPress 优化的服务器
- WP 训练有素的支持
- SSL证书
- 随着网站的发展而扩展的能力
现在,最后一个特别重要,因为每个网站管理员都应该为增长做计划。 这就是为什么我们可以安全地推荐云 VPS 解决方案作为多站点项目的首选。这种类型的托管不仅带有一组专用的系统资源,而且还提供增强的安全性和对环境的控制。
您可以随时监控您的服务器使用情况,这样您就可以提前知道您是否接近达到任何限制。但即使是这样,云技术也将确保您永远不会耗尽任何CPU、RAM 或磁盘空间。
结论
如果您想创建一个新社区或已经是其中的一员 – WordPress Multisite 绝对是您最有利的选择之一。这个强大的工具将允许您设置整个网站网络并为不同的用户分配访问权限,而无需任何先前的技术经验。